基準

kijun [kiʑɯɴ]

A standard, criterion, or benchmark used as a basis for measurement, judgment, or evaluation. It refers to the specific rules or requirements that something must meet to be accepted or classified in a certain way.

예시

1

このテストの合格基準は70点です。

everyday

The passing standard for this test is 70 points.

2

新しい安全基準が来月から適用されます。

formal

New safety standards will be applied starting next month.

3

君が友達を選ぶ基準って何?

informal

What are your criteria for choosing friends?

4

本研究では、以下の基準に基づいてデータを分類した。

academic

In this study, data were classified based on the following criteria.

5

わが社は採用基準を見直す必要があります。

business

Our company needs to review its hiring criteria.

자주 쓰는 조합

基準を満たす to meet the criteria
基準を設ける to set a standard
判断基準 judgment criteria
安全基準 safety standards
基準値 reference value / standard value

자주 쓰는 구문

基準に達する

to reach the standard

基準をクリアする

to clear (pass) the criteria

厳しい基準

strict standards

자주 혼동되는 단어

基準 vs 標準 (Hyoujun)

Hyoujun refers to an average or common level, while Kijun refers to a specific rule or requirement for judgment.

📝

사용 참고사항

Use this word when discussing formal rules, requirements for passing, or the 'yardstick' by which something is measured. It is common in both daily life (exams) and professional settings (laws, engineering).

⚠️

자주 하는 실수

Learners sometimes use 基準 when they mean 'average' (標準). Also, remember that it is a noun and usually takes particles like 'を' or 'に'.

💡

암기 팁

Visualize a ruler (Jun/準 means level) placed on a foundation (Ki/基 means base). It is the 'base level' you must reach.

📖

어원

Derived from the kanji 基 (foundation/basis) and 準 (standard/level/correspond).

문법 패턴

〜を基準にする (to use ~ as a standard) 〜の基準 (criteria of ~)
🌍

문화적 맥락

Japan is known for its strict 'JIS' (Japanese Industrial Standards), so the word 基準 frequently appears in discussions about quality and safety.
